At least 12 people were injured on Friday (23) in a knife attack at the main Hamburg train station in the north of the northern, the firefighters and the local police, who arrested a suspect reported. “One person wounded several others with a knife at the central station,” said Hamburg police on the X. “The suspect was arrested by the response forces,” he added.
A spokesman for the city’s Fire Department stated that the aggressor left “three light, three bass and six in critical condition.” Some victims were attended on trains, according to the German newspaper Bild.
In recent months, Germany has been shaken by a series of violent attacks with jihadist and far -right motivation, who have put the security issues in the foreground.
Last weekend, four people were injured in a white gun attack in Bielefeld in the west of the country. The alleged perpetrator is a 35 -year -old Syrian, arrested by the authorities, who suspect an Islamist attack.
